Ingredients: Easy Healthy Chili

Here’s what you’ll need to create this comforting and nutritious chili:
- * 1 tsp olive oil
- * 1 lb lean ground beef (I use 90/10 or 93/7 for a lean chili)
- * 1 medium white onion, diced
- * 1 tbsp minced garlic
- * 1 15oz can kidney beans, drained and rinsed
- * 1 15oz can diced tomatoes, undrained
- * 2 cups beef bone broth (low sodium preferred)
- * 2 tbsp chili powder
- * 2 tsp paprika
- * 1 tsp cumin
- * 1 tsp dried oregano
- * 1 tsp salt
- * 1/4 tsp black pepper
- Optional Garnishes:* Fresh parsley, shredded cheddar cheese (in moderation!), a dollop of Greek yogurt or sour cream.
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Sauté the Aromatics: Heat the olive o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ium heat. Add the diced onion and cook until softened, about 5-7 minutes. Add the min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ant. Chef Tip: Don’t rush this step! Properly sautéed onions and garlic form the flavor base of the entire chili.
2. Brown the Beef: Add the lean ground beef to the pot and break it up with a spoon. Cook until browned, about 7-10 minutes. Drain off any excess grease. Shortcut: Use pre-cooked ground beef to save even more time!
3. Add the Spices: Stir in the chili powder, paprika, cumin, oregano, salt, and pepper. Cook for 1 minute, stirring constantly, to toast the spices and release their flavors. Chef Tip: Blooming the spices in oil is a crucial step for a flavorful chili.
4. Combine the Ingredients: Add the drained kidney beans, diced tomatoes (with their juice), and beef bone broth to the pot. Stir well to combine.
5. Simmer to Perfection: Bring the chili to a boil, then re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for at least 20 minutes, or up to an hour, stirring occasionally. The longer it simmers, the more the flavors will meld together. Chef Tip: A low and slow simmer is key for tender beef and a rich, developed flavor.
6. Taste and Adjust: Taste the chili and adjust the seasonings as needed. You may want to add more chili powder for heat, salt for flavor, or a pinch of sugar to balance the acidity of the tomatoes.
7. Serve and Garnish: Ladle the Easy Healthy Chili into bowls and garnish with your favorite toppings, such as fresh parsley, a sprinkle of cheddar cheese, or a dollop of Greek yogurt.

Storage, Freezing, and Reheating Tips

Leftover Easy Healthy Chili can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. For longer storage, this quick chili recipe freezes beautifully! Allow the chili to cool completely before transferring it to freezer-safe containers or zip-top bags. It can be frozen for up to 3 months.
To reheat, thaw the chili overnight in the refrigerator. Then, reheat it on the stovetop over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until heated through. You can also reheat it in the microwave in a microwave-safe bowl. Adding a splash of beef broth during reheating can help restore some of the moisture.

H3: What are the leanest meat options for chili?
When making a lean chili, choosing the right meat is crucial. Ground turkey or chicken are excellent alternatives to beef, offering a significantly lower fat content. If you prefer beef, opt for 93/7 ground beef or even leaner. You can also use ground sirloin, which is naturally lean. Another option is to use cubed beef chuck, trimmed of any visible fat, and allow it to simmer for a longer period to become tender. Remember to drain off any excess grease after browning the meat.

How do you make chili flavorful without excess fat?
The secret to flavorful chili without excess fat lies in the spices and simmering process. Toasting the spices in olive oil before adding the other ingredients releases their aromas and enhances their flavor.
Using beef bone broth provides a rich, savory base. Allowing the chili to simmer for at least 20 minutes, or even longer, allows the flavors to meld together and deepen. Don’t be afraid to experiment with different spice combinations to find your perfect blend!
